+ -
当前位置:首页 → 问答吧 →  SO 一定要拷贝到系统目录下才可以运行码?

SO 一定要拷贝到系统目录下才可以运行码?

时间:2011-10-24

来源:互联网

我写了个SO。导出函数

然后写了个控制台程序,使用了 so 里面的函数,我编译后,运行,他提示找不到这个so 。。。我想让so 就和 程序在一个目录下运行怎么做?

作者: aaadddzxc   发布时间: 2011-10-24

error while loading shared libraries: 123.so: cannot open shared object file: No such file or directory
在运行的时候提示!

123.so明明就在当前目录下!

作者: aaadddzxc   发布时间: 2011-10-24

export LD_LIBRARY_PATH=${LD_LIBRARY_PTAH}:.

作者: qq120848369   发布时间: 2011-10-24

需要让系统知道去哪些目录寻找这些so文件,否则只会去默认目录下寻找,试试2L的方法,把当前的目录加入寻找路径中

作者: thefirstz   发布时间: 2011-10-24

export LD_LIBRARY_PATH=${LD_LIBRARY_PTAH}:.

正解~

作者: lgxwqq111   发布时间: 2011-10-24

热门下载

更多